> i would be very interested in more detailed info how and why GEM and  
> pyext don't cohabitate well.
> Vanishing object boxes have in all cases i got to know of been caused  
> by version mismatches of PD or flext headers and libraries and have  
> been resolved by downloading or checking out an up-to-date flext  
> version and recompiling flext and the objects.

Sounds like a great reason for the Pd-extended builds.  The idea is to  
have everything compiled at once...  Now if only I could get Pd to  
compile using MinGW...
